2.1 Identify Your Target Audience

 

First and foremost, you must realize that not all people intend to check out your website, nor is that required. You need to aim at and attract the exact market segment that is interested in your services or products.

 

Attempting to please everyone seldom leads to success; the case is similar when discussing websites. Once you have learned what demography (age, gender, region, occupation, etc.) you want to attract and what content they like, everything becomes more accessible – content creation, marketing, design, development, and analysis.

 

You must note that you cannot realistically have just one target audience. You may have two or three types of user bases. You need to identify these distinctive audiences and monitor their behavior on your site. User behavior includes what pages they stay on longer, what they click, which pages they rarely visit or leave early, and so on.

With this knowledge, you can curate personalized content your audience might like, and place calls to action (CTAs) where they are most likely to react. If you want to create an online store for your business, study the common mistakes eCommerce startups make and how you can avoid them.

2.3 Clear Organization of Content

 

An intuitive website must have a lucid hierarchy and structure. Your grouping of products and content should be easy to access and enable users to open every page from the navigation menu.

 

Content categorization also impacts your SEO efforts and performance. The more straightforward visitors locate what they want, the more they are likely to interact with your platform. The pyramid structure of website navigation is an effective way of achieving this. It allows search engine algorithms to crawl your pages easily and improves search rankings.

2.4 Easily Readable Content

 

Your pages may have beautiful visuals and design, but users will soon lose interest if your information and articles are challenging to read. Massive volumes of text give the impression that they will take hours to read and deter visitors from engaging with your content. You also need to optimize your content for mobile devices, as a significant share of internet users prefer smartphones over PCs.

 

The first step in this regard is to avoid large blocks of text and split them into smaller paragraphs. You should create proper headings, subheadings, and bullet points and embolden essential parts of sentences. It is also crucial to use consistent typography and visuals throughout your site.

 

You need to make the language and tone readable as well. Refrain from using bombastic language that turns your page into research papers that thwart the interest of visitors and potential customers. Use tools like Grammarly and Readability Analyzer to evaluate your content based on grammar and readability.

2.5 Add a Search Feature

 

While it is vital to have proper menus and navigation, users find it easier to jump precisely to what they are looking for using the search option. In addition to this obvious benefit, the search feature has another crucial role. It enables you to learn more about users based on their search intent.

Knowing what your visitors search for most often and which page they start from lets you make effective adjustments to your site and make it more intuitive. This also facilitates conversions and provides fresh insights into what other products or services you can offer.

3.1 Keyword Research and Implementation

 

Keywords are the exact search terms that users type in as queries when they look for information or products online – for example, “best hairdresser in Manhattan” or “buy gym equipment online.”

 

When incorporated optimally into your content, these keywords signal to Google’s crawlers that your page contains what the searcher wants. This improves your rankings and facilitates organic traffic growth.

 

You can use tools such as Google Keyword Planner, Ahrefs, Semrush, Moz Keyword Explorer, and Answer the Public to understand search intent and decide which keywords to pick. You can also compare similar keywords in terms of search volume and competition based on location and demographic factors.

 

However, you must understand that the days of keyword stuffing are long gone, and it’s no longer possible to rank sub-par content by cramming it with keywords. Google’s algorithms are improving by that day and can penalize your pages, leading to even worse rankings. 3.2 Ensure Fast Load Times

 

From ordering food to investing and withdrawing money, we want speed in all of our day-to-day work. Website speed is no different and strongly influences your SEO performance and traffic. None of the other tips in this article will be relevant if your pages take too long to load.

 

Users find slow leading a huge turn-off, and search engine algorithms know it. A slow page simply does not rank on the first page of Google in this day and age. Make it a point to optimize your image files, code, and design elements for speed.

 

You must also use tools such as Google PageSpeed Insights, Pingdom Speed Test, Chrome DevTools, and WebPage Test to check and improve your pages’ loading times. 3.3 Backlinking and Interlinking

 

When another website passes a link to yours on any of its pages, it is regarded as a backlink. Backlinks from high-authority websites are considered as seals of trust for your brand. It is also a signal to search engine crawlers that other sites have found your content relevant. This further improves your rankings on result pages.

 

An interlink is when you pass a link to another relevant page of your site. Appropriate interlinks help enhance the user experience and improve your site’s engagement metrics.

 

When users go from one page on your site to another and find value, your average dwell time increases. In addition, backlinks, when used correctly, are a solid indication to search engines on which of your pages you want to rank.

 

You should also prioritize the links in your footer section. Include the most popular pages of your website as they drive curiosity among users. It also enables them to quickly understand what your website is about and what solutions or products they can expect.
